Understanding the Roots of the Iran Israel Conflict

To really get a grip on the Iran Israel conflict news, you've gotta understand that this isn't some new spat that popped up overnight. Nah, guys, this has been brewing for decades. Think back to the Iranian Revolution in 1979. That was a major turning point, establishing a government that was fundamentally opposed to Israel's existence and US influence in the region. Since then, it's been a constant back-and-forth, a strategic game of chess with incredibly high stakes. Iran sees Israel as an illegitimate entity and a major threat to its regional ambitions, while Israel views Iran's nuclear program and its support for proxy groups like Hezbollah and Hamas as an existential danger. This deep ideological divide fuels much of the tension. Furthermore, geopolitical factors play a massive role. Both nations are vying for dominance in the Middle East, a region incredibly rich in resources and strategically vital. Israel, with its strong alliance with the United States, often finds itself in direct opposition to Iran's regional strategies. Iran, on the other hand, has cultivated a network of allies and proxies, creating a multi-front challenge for Israel and its partners. The news about Iran Israel conflict often highlights these proxy wars, where both sides support opposing factions in conflicts across Syria, Lebanon, Yemen, and Iraq. These indirect confrontations allow both Iran and Israel to project power and influence without engaging in direct, all-out war, though the risk of escalation is always present. Recent Escalations and Key Events

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of what's been happening lately in the Iran Israel conflict news. The past year or so has seen a significant uptick in direct and indirect confrontations. We've witnessed targeted strikes attributed to Israel against Iranian-linked targets in Syria, often aimed at disrupting weapons shipments and dismantling Iranian military infrastructure. Iran, in response, has often retaliated through its proxy forces or by launching drone and missile attacks. A particularly tense period occurred when Iran launched an unprecedented direct missile and drone attack on Israel. This was a massive escalation, as Iran had historically relied on its proxies to do the fighting. Israel, with the help of allies like the US, UK, and Jordan, managed to intercept most of these projectiles, but the sheer audacity of the attack sent shockwaves across the globe. Following this, Israel carried out retaliatory strikes within Iran, marking a direct exchange of fire between the two nations for the first time in their history. These events are not isolated incidents; they are part of a broader pattern of escalating tensions. The news surrounding the Iran Israel conflict also frequently covers alleged sabotage operations, cyberattacks, and assassinations targeting individuals linked to either side's nuclear or military programs. For instance, there have been numerous reports of explosions at Iranian nuclear facilities and the killings of prominent Iranian scientists, with Israel widely suspected of being behind these actions. Conversely, Iran has been accused of attacks on Israeli-linked shipping in the Persian Gulf and alleged plots against Israeli targets abroad. The Role of Proxy Groups and Regional Dynamics

When we talk about the Iran Israel conflict news, it's impossible to ignore the crucial role that proxy groups play. Seriously, guys, these groups are like Iran's extended arms, allowing Tehran to project power and exert influence across the region without directly committing its own forces. Think Hezbollah in Lebanon, Hamas and Palestinian Islamic Jihad in Gaza, and the Houthi rebels in Yemen. These organizations receive funding, training, and weapons from Iran, and in return, they often act on Iran's behalf, challenging Israel and its allies. For Israel, these proxies represent a significant security threat. Hezbollah, with its vast arsenal of rockets and missiles, poses a constant danger to northern Israel, and Hamas and Islamic Jihad have been responsible for numerous attacks on Israeli civilians. The news about Iran Israel conflict often highlights the intertwined nature of these conflicts. For example, the ongoing war in Gaza, sparked by Hamas's attack on Israel, has been met with increased cross-border fire from Hezbollah in the north, further stretching Israel's resources and escalating regional tensions. Iran's support for these groups is not just about military aid; it's also about ideological alignment and maintaining a network of resistance against Israel and its Western backers. Israel, in turn, works to counter these threats through various means, including airstrikes on Syrian soil to disrupt weapons transfers to Hezbollah and operations aimed at weakening Hamas. The regional dynamics are incredibly complex, with other major players like Saudi Arabia, the UAE, and Turkey also having their own interests and rivalries with Iran.
